Full description from employer

We have an opportunity to impact your career and provide an adventure where you can push the limits of what's possible. 

As a Lead Software Engineer (VP) - Valuation Control Group Technology at JPMorganChase within the Valuation Control Group Technology Team, you are an integral part of an agile team that works to enhance, build, and deliver trusted market-leading technology products in a secure, stable, and scalable way. 
As a core technical contributor, you are responsible for conducting critical technology solutions across multiple technical areas within various business functions in support of the firm’s business objectives. 

Job Responsibilities
 
  • Lead end-to-end architecture for Athena (Python), Databricks (PySpark/Delta Lake), and AWS-based valuation control platforms.
  • Develop and enhance pricing, risk, IPV, valuation adjustment, and fair value reporting tools within Athena.
  • Design, build, and optimize large-scale Databricks ETL and analytics pipelines for pricing, market, and P&L data.
  • Architect and manage cloud-native AWS solutions, including infrastructure, security, automation, and modernization initiatives.
  • Establish engineering best practices, code quality standards, CI/CD processes, testing frameworks, and production monitoring.
  • Deliver automation and controls for independent price verification, valuation uncertainty detection, reconciliations, and regulatory compliance.
  • Collaborate with valuation control, risk, finance, quants, and business stakeholders to define requirements and drive Agile delivery.
  • Provide technical leadership, mentor engineering teams, oversee production support, and ensure scalable, auditable, and resilient solutions.
  • Drives team adoption of enterprise-authorized AI-assisted engineering practices within the work environment to improve code quality, delivery speed, and operational outcomes (e.g., AI-assisted code review/refactoring, test strategy acceleration, incident/root-cause analysis support), while establishing consistent validation standards (secure coding, peer review, automated testing) and promoting reuse of effective patterns across the team.
  • Applies knowledge of tools within the Software Development Life Cycle toolchain, including enterprise-authorized AI-assisted development and automation capabilities, to improve the value realized by automation.

 

Required Qualifications

  • Formal training or certification on software engineering concepts and 5+ years applied experience 

  • Extensive Python engineering experience; with hands-on platform experience and financial application engineering (derivatives pricing, risk management, trade booking, and quantitative analytics etc.).

  • Strong Databricks / Apache Spark experience (PySpark, Delta Lake, performance tuning).

  • Solid hands-on AWS experience across core services (S3, EC2, Lambda, IAM, and container/orchestration services), with an understanding of cloud security and cost management.

  • Solid grasp of financial products, valuation/pricing concepts, and market data.

  • Proven experience leading engineering teams and delivering in a controlled, regulated environment.

  • Strong SQL, data modeling, and data-quality engineering skills.

  • Excellent stakeholder management and the ability to bridge business and technical domains.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Knowledge of IPV, prudent valuation, XVA, or fair-value reserve methodologies.
  • Experience with reactive/streaming computation and real-time dashboards.
  • Infrastructure-as-code (Terraform/CloudFormation), CI/CD, and modern DevOps practices on AWS.
  • AWS certification (e.g., Solutions Architect, Developer, or Data Engineer Associate/Professional).
